In today's fast-paced world, it's common to experience emotional exhaustion. Emotional exhaustion occurs when prolonged stress, overwhelming responsibilities, and intense emotions deplete our mental and physical energy. It can manifest as feelings of chronic fatigue, apathy, irritability, and a reduced ability to cope with daily challenges. However, by implementing effective strategies, we can regain control and prevent emotional exhaustion from taking over our lives.

Ways To Control Emotional Exhaustion

Here are various methods to manage and control emotional exhaustion, helping you restore balance and promote overall well-being:

1. Self-Care

Engaging in regular self-care activities is crucial for managing emotional exhaustion. Set aside time for activities that rejuvenate your mind, body, and spirit. Prioritise activities such as exercise, meditation, deep breathing exercises, spending time in nature, journaling, pursuing hobbies, and connecting with loved ones. Taking care of yourself allows you to recharge and build resilience against emotional exhaustion.

2. Establish Boundaries

Setting clear boundaries is essential to prevent emotional exhaustion. Learn to say no to excessive commitments and understand your limitations. Communicate your needs to others and prioritise self-preservation. By establishing healthy boundaries, you can protect your energy and avoid becoming overwhelmed by external demands.

3. Practise Stress Management Techniques

Chronic stress contributes significantly to emotional exhaustion. Incorporate stress management techniques into your daily routine. Explore mindfulness-based practices like yoga or meditation, engage in regular physical exercise, and practise relaxation techniques such as progressive muscle relaxation or guided imagery. These techniques help reduce stress levels, promote relaxation, and restore emotional balance.

4. Seek Support

Seeking support from friends, family, or a therapist can be invaluable in managing emotional exhaustion. Sharing your feelings with trusted individuals can provide emotional validation and practical advice. Additionally, professional therapists can help you develop coping strategies, navigate challenges, and gain a fresh perspective on your experiences.

5. Prioritise Sleep

Adequate sleep plays a vital role in emotional well-being. Establish a consistent sleep routine and create a restful environment conducive to quality sleep. Avoid stimulants like caffeine before bedtime, limit screen time, and practise relaxation techniques to prepare your body and mind for sleep. By ensuring sufficient rest, you enhance your ability to manage stress and prevent emotional exhaustion.

6. Practise Emotional Regulation

Emotional regulation skills are crucial in preventing emotional exhaustion. Cultivate self-awareness and identify triggers that lead to emotional exhaustion. Develop healthy coping mechanisms such as practising gratitude, engaging in positive self-talk, and reframing negative situations. Implementing emotional regulation techniques allows you to manage emotions effectively and prevents them from becoming overwhelming.

7. Time Management

Poor time management can contribute to emotional exhaustion. Organise your tasks and prioritise them based on importance and urgency. Break down large tasks into smaller, manageable steps. Delegate tasks when possible and avoid overcommitting. By managing your time effectively, you reduce stress levels and create a sense of accomplishment, reducing the risk of emotional exhaustion.

8. Engage in Healthy Lifestyle Habits

Adopting a healthy lifestyle is crucial for emotional well-being. Ensure you maintain a balanced diet, rich in nutrients, and avoid excessive consumption of processed foods, alcohol, and caffeine. Regular physical activity promotes the release of endorphins, improving mood and reducing stress. Hydrate adequately, as dehydration can contribute to fatigue and irritability. By prioritising a healthy lifestyle, you equip yourself with the physical and mental resources necessary to combat emotional exhaustion.

Bottomline

Emotional exhaustion can significantly impact our overall well-being, but it is within our power to control and prevent it. By incorporating these strategies into our daily lives, we can cultivate emotional resilience, manage stress effectively, and regain a sense of balance.
